Job SummaryThe Patient Care Technician (PCT) provides care to patients with end-stage renal disease, supporting clinical staff throughout the dialysis treatment process to deliver prescribed treatments.
Our PCTs are an integral part of the interdisciplinary team in ensuring safe care and the highest quality outcomes for every patient.
Responsibilities- Actively participate in infection control, risk management, and patient education activities
- Guide new patients through a comprehensive education plan
- Obtain and record patient vital signs and machine readings during treatment
- Role under RN supervision
- Set up and break down dialysis blood system for treatment
- Insert and remove patient access needles
- Monitor patients during dialysis, document changes, and inform charge nurse of any concerns
- Calculate patient's weight loss to reach dry weight
- Determine patient care priorities and organize workload accordingly
- Maintain professional working relationships, observing patient privacy and rights
- Maintain and track inventory
- Perform laboratory work
